How to Replace a Kia Sportage Replacement Key

For a number of Kia models, the key contains the keyless entry system that is built into the key. The key functions like a remote control and is exchangeable by a Kia dealer.

Key fobs can stop working for several reasons, including a dead coin battery, worn buttons signal interference, water damage and cs.xuxingdianzikeji.com a damaged receiver module. Here are some helpful tips on how you can get your Kia Sportage replacement key working again.

How to replace a remote key or a smartkey?

The battery in your Kia's intelligent key will eventually need be replaced, whether it's a remote, a push-to-start key or a regular key that does not contain a transponder. This is particularly relevant if your vehicle displays a message that indicates that the smart key or remote is not powered by the battery.

It's a fairly simple process. In order to replace the battery in the key fob remove the mechanical key from the hole in the back of the key fob. Next, pry open the cover. Inside the key fob, there will be a small screw that holds the battery in its place. Using a small screwdriver, take the screw off and remove the battery that was in place. Then insert the new one and close the slit inside the key fob.

Test the key fob by pressing the lock and unlock buttons. It's okay if the doors lock and unlock as expected. You can now use the hands-free feature to lock and unlock your Kia whenever your fingers feel cold or you need to complete errands in Brandon.

Note: Some key fobs (transponder chip or smart keys) may require their programming done. This requires a specific programming machine that only the dealer or locksmith has access to. Other keys (non transponder keys made of steel), do not need programming. If your key needs to be programmed again, you must be aware of the key code number stamped on the key code tag and keep it in a safe place.

How do you replace a smart keys

Depending on the model of the Kia Keyless Entry Remote Sportage, you may have an ordinary key fob or a smart key. The difference is that the smart key has tiny mechanical key blade hidden within it, whereas the standard fob doesn't. Both types of key fobs are equipped with a battery inside them that will eventually have to be replaced. This is a simple procedure which takes just two minutes.

Before you start before you begin, make sure that you are on a flat surface with adequate lighting and that the kia sportage key replacement cost uk is off. Remember that the fob can contain tiny pieces that could fall if you're not careful.

The first step is to locate the small release button that is located on the backside of the fob. This will either be a circular silver button or a rectangular slot. You can open the key fob by pressing the button.

Once the key fob is opened, remove the old battery. The new battery should be a CR-2032 and can be bought online or from your local auto parts store. When you're done, the key fob should allow you to lock and unlock your vehicle, even if it isn't running.
